The country, Turkey, had to repay. This review required that Turkey meet certain aims of financial management.
The country's long-term goal would be reached if the EU's required standards were fulfilled. The absolute majority holding government in Turkey’s parliament assured to meet both IMF and EU requirements. Prime Minister Erdogan planned to establish that Turkey was a stable, secular democracy, although his AKP party had Islamic origins. After Turkey fulfilled the EU's conditions, the question remained: Would the EU's "Christian club" accept a Muslim Turkey?
